Uyghur discus thrower Abdugeni Turgun won the championship in Germany and broke the record in the event once again.
According to China People's Daily, Asian champion Abdugeni Turgun once again showed his skills in the track and field shooting event of the sports competition held in Neubrandenburg, Germany, on June 11, throwing 65.69 meters and 67.29 meters to win the championship. With these results, he also twice broke the men's discus record of 65.35 meters that he set in April this year.
In April this year, 28-year-old discus thrower Abdugeni Turgun participated in the shooting event of the 2025 Chinese Athletics Championships held in Chengdu, China. It broke the Chinese record in the discus throw that had stood since 1996 with a result of 65.35 meters. He has now extended his record by another two meters.
